Adv Suresh greets people on Baisakhi
4/13/2020 12:02:08 AM

Early Times Report

Jammu, Apr 12: Adv.Suresh Kumar Dogra Chairman OBC Deptt. Pradesh Congress Committie J&K along with other Leaders of the Department greets the peoples of India especially the Resident of Jammu and Kashmir on occasion of Baisakhi Festival, Adv.Suresh Kumar Dogra said that this Baisakhi festival is the mark of the beginning of new year in the Indian calendar, has a special significance of the peoples of Northern India.Baisakhi also Marks the commencement of harvesting season,when farmer reap the fruit of thier hard work. Adv.Dogra added that that this Festival is a symbol of spirit of our traditions and customs of observing Baisakhi with communal harmony and mutual Brother adds colour to its festivity. All the Leaders prayed to Almighty that this Baisakhi Festival may bring peace,affection and Integrity in the Country and also appeal to peoples to maintain social distances and to observe law and order
